Details to remove the trackpad of ASUS Chromebook Flip C100PA-RBRKT07

    • Use the T5 screwdriver to remove the nine 2.1 mm screws from the bottom of the device.

    • Use the iFixit opening tool to remove the 4 pads to reveal six 3.1 mm screws underneath.

    • Use the T5 screwdriver to remove the six 3.1 mm screws under the pads.

    • There might be a layer of tape that covers the screws. Remove the tape first with a pair of tweezers.

    • Use the iFixit opening tool to remove the back of the laptop.

    • Use the blunt nose tweezers to separate the keyboard from the internal components.

    • Grip the keyboard and carefully pull it off the device.

    • On the back of the keyboard assembly, use the tweezers to pull the white cable from the track pad.

    • Remove the three 1 mm screws from the track pad using the JIS 00 screwdriver.

    • Grip the track pad with the tweezers and slide it up and out of the keyboard assembly.

Conclusion

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
